A comprehensive guide to the Ethereum network, from smart contracts to dapps and gas fees, explained in detail.
Key Takeaways:
- Ethereum, co-created by Vitalik Buterin, is a platform supporting digital currency, smart contracts, and decentralised applications (dapps).
- Ether (ETH) is Ethereum’s native cryptocurrency, used to fuel the network, with gas fees acting as transaction costs determined by supply, demand, and network capacity.
- Unlike Bitcoin, Ethereum enables complex applications like smart contracts and dapps.
- Ethereum uses Proof of Stake (PoS), where validators create and validate blocks, making it energy-efficient compared to Proof of Work (PoW) blockchains.
- The 2022 transition from PoW to PoS reduced Ethereum’s energy consumption by 99.95%, lowered ETH issuance, and improved scalability.
- Continuous upgrades like The Merge, Shapella, and Dencun enhance Ethereum’s versatility across industries.
Introduction
Ethereum has revolutionised digital transactions and blockchain technology. This guide explores its blockchain, consensus mechanism, smart contracts, and the Ethereum Virtual Machine (EVM). Learn how Ethereum works, its key features, and the role of Ether (ETH) in powering the network.
👉 Discover more about Ethereum’s potential
The Ethereum Blockchain: A Decentralised Network
What Is a Blockchain?
A blockchain is a distributed ledger shared across a network of nodes. It stores data in cryptographically linked blocks, ensuring transparency and immutability—key for industries requiring secure records.
The Role of Nodes
Nodes maintain Ethereum’s decentralised nature by:
- Verifying transactions and validating blocks.
- Executing smart contracts.
- Synchronising blockchain data.
- Running client software to interact with the network.
In Ethereum’s PoS system, validator nodes propose new blocks based on staked ETH, replacing energy-intensive mining.
How Ethereum Differs From Bitcoin
| Feature | Bitcoin | Ethereum |
|---|---|---|
| Purpose | Digital currency | Platform for smart contracts/dapps |
| Consensus | Proof of Work (PoW) | Proof of Stake (PoS) |
| Flexibility | Limited scripting | Robust smart contract support |
Consensus Mechanisms: From PoW to PoS
Ethereum Proof of Work Explained
PoW required miners to solve puzzles, consuming significant energy (21 TWh annually). While secure, it was inefficient.
Ethereum’s Transition to Proof of Stake
The 2022 Merge to PoS introduced:
- Energy efficiency: 99.95% reduction in consumption.
- Lower ETH issuance: From 5.4 million to ~816,000 ETH yearly.
- Enhanced security: Block finalisation prevents tampering.
- Scalability: Consistent 12-second block times.
Challenges include centralisation risks, e.g., Lido controlling ~28% of staked ETH.
Smart Contracts: The Heart of Ethereum
Smart contracts are self-executing programs on Ethereum, automating transactions without intermediaries.
How Ethereum’s Smart Contracts Work
Operate on "if-this-then-that" logic, written in Solidity, and deployed immutably to the blockchain.
Real-World Applications
- DeFi: Decentralised lending/exchanges (e.g., Uniswap).
- Supply Chains: Transparent tracking.
- Voting: Secure, tamper-proof systems.
- Arts: Royalty management via NFTs.
👉 Explore smart contract use cases
Ethereum Virtual Machine (EVM)
What Is EVM?
The EVM is Ethereum’s runtime environment for smart contracts, functioning as a global, Turing-complete virtual machine.
How the EVM Processes Smart Contracts
- Transaction initiation.
- Verification and execution context setup.
- Opcode execution with gas management.
- State changes propagated network-wide.
Dapps on Ethereum
Decentralised applications (dapps) run on blockchain, offering censorship resistance and transparency.
Popular Ethereum-Based Dapps
- Uniswap: Decentralised exchange handling billions in trades.
- Aave: DeFi lending platform with $12.6B locked (2024).
Ether and Gas: Fuelling the Ethereum Network
Understanding Ether (ETH)
ETH powers Ethereum, enabling transactions and smart contracts. It’s traded as an investment like Bitcoin.
Gas Fees Explained
Gas fees = (Gas used) × (Base fee + Priority fee). Prices fluctuate based on network demand.
How to Buy ETH
ETH can be purchased on exchanges using fiat or other cryptocurrencies.
Conclusion
Ethereum’s smart contracts and dapps redefine blockchain applications. Its PoS transition boosts sustainability, with ongoing upgrades enhancing scalability. As adoption grows, Ethereum’s role in industries like finance and art will expand.
FAQ Section
Q: What is the difference between Ethereum and Bitcoin?
A: Bitcoin is primarily a digital currency, while Ethereum supports smart contracts and dapps.
Q: How does Proof of Stake improve Ethereum?
A: PoS reduces energy use by 99.95% and improves scalability.
Q: What are gas fees?
A: Transaction fees paid in ETH to process operations on Ethereum.
Q: Can smart contracts be altered after deployment?
A: No, they are immutable once deployed.
Q: What is the EVM?
A: The Ethereum Virtual Machine executes smart contracts across the network.
Q: How do I buy ETH?
A: Through crypto exchanges using fiat or other cryptocurrencies.